MATTHEW WILLIAMSON - a large Future Heirloom Embellished hobo handbag. Designed with multicoloured geometric embroidery and a detailed embellished exterior, featuring intricate metallic beads and sequins surrounding mirrored circular plates and clusters of large glass and stone beads, metallic silver leather base, trim and top handles, a detachable crossbody strap, brushed gunmetal hardware, a thin strap clip fastening and pink satin interior lining. Measuring 19 by 37 by 42cms. With maker's dust bag, care card and purchase tag.

Condition Report
Bag is in very good condition overall. The embellished exterior is in good condition, the bead work is all intact with no noticeable signs of wear. The base of the bag has a few minor marks that are hardly noticeable and the stud feet are slightly scuffed. The handles and detachable strap are in all good condition with little sign of wear. There is slight creasing to the leather loops where the handles attach and very minor scratches to the gunmetal hardware. The piping around the opening of the bag has a few little scuffs. Interior is clean and in very good condition. Bag is with makers dust bag and care card.
